The Chávez Jr. Case: A Recap

Julio César Chávez Jr., son of boxing legend Julio César Chávez, was deported to Mexico on August 18th after being arrested in Los Angeles. ICE stated that Chávez Jr. had an active arrest warrant in Mexico related to organized crime and firearms trafficking. He had initially entered the U.S. legally with a tourist visa that expired in February 2024. According to the DHS, Chavez Jr. also made fraudulent statements on a recent immigration application.

The arrest and deportation followed an incident where the boxer was found guilty of “illegal possession of any assault weapon and manufacturing or importing a short-barreled rifle.” This confluence of factors ultimately led to his removal from the United States.

This incident underscores the complexities of immigration law and the consequences of overstaying visas and engaging in criminal activity.

The Dawn of Humanoid Robots in Real-World Sports

In a groundbreaking event, Tiangong, a humanoid robot developed by Chinese company Humanoid, became the first to complete a city marathon route in Beijing. This marathon was historic as it featured robots running alongside human athletes, paving the way for future technological integration in sports.

Breaking New Grounds in Marathon Competitions

At the Yizhuang district’s technology park, Tiangong showcased remarkable endurance, finishing the 21-kilometer wall with a steady pace of 7 to 8 km/h. Despite needing battery changes and experiencing a fall, Tiangong’s achievements underscore the potential for robots in extreme conditions. Its mission was threefold: to win, complete the race solo, and finish in under three hours.

Humanoid Rivalry: The N2 and Boxer DroidUp

Rival robots like N2 from Noetix and DroidUp, nicknamed “the boxer” for its striking gloves, also demonstrated impressive capabilities. The N2, designed with more human-like features, strategically overtook DroidUp, illustrating burgeoning machine strategy.

Teething Issues and the Future of Robotics

Despite three to four robots maintaining a consistent pace, most competitors struggled, withdrawing just meters from the start line. This challenges current robotic endurance and technology, marking a clear path for development.

China’s Technological Vanguard

This event didn’t just highlight robotic prowess; drones and electric vehicles from companies like Xiaomi added layers of technological flair, exhibiting China’s growing tech dominance.

Applications Beyond Sports

Xiong Youjun from Humanoid emphasizes that these feats are testing grounds, with the ultimate goal of creating robots capable of operating in hazardous conditions. This could revolutionize safety in fields like search and rescue, space exploration, and hazardous waste management.
